H3: Grasping Waukesha’s Climate and Its Impact on Concrete Durability


Waukesha experiences a range of weather conditions – from hot summers to cold winters – impacting the durability and performance of concrete surfaces.

Local contractors understand how freeze-thaw cycles, moisture, and temperature swings can lead to cracks and surface wear.

They apply this expertise to modify mixing, pouring, and curing methods to ensure durable installations.


Regional specialists frequently suggest the use of targeted additives and curing methods to help hold up against seasonal changes.

Key Factors Affecting Concrete Project Expenses in Waukesha


The total expense of a concrete project can depend on several factors. Some key drivers include the dimensions of the project, the concrete composition, the intricacy of the design, and extra features such as decorative finishes. Moreover, local material rates, transportation costs, and contractor expertise can affect the final quote.


Make a list of what’s needed for your project, such as driveways, patios, or sidewalks, and then get comprehensive quotes. Requesting a detailed itemization helps you comprehend the allocation of your budget and makes comparisons between contractors easier. Common Durations for Residential and Commercial Concrete Projects



Residential concrete projects, such as a new patio or driveway, may take just a few days if conditions are favorable. Factors like size and weather can either shorten or extend the period. Business projects usually entail additional stages such as design assessments and recurring inspections, which might stretch the timeline to several weeks.


Review the anticipated timeline with your contractor at the outset. They can detail the steps ranging from planning to curing, and describe the impact of Waukesha's weather on each phase. Advice for Preserving Your Concrete in Waukesha


Seasonal Maintenance Advice to Prevent Cracking and Damage


Waukesha’s shifting seasons mean concrete needs regular care to stay in top shape. Basic activities such as removing debris and fixing minor cracks quickly can prolong your concrete's lifespan. During the winter, a local contractor may suggest using sealants that protect surfaces from freeze-thaw damage.

When to Schedule Repairs or Replacements


Knowing when to repair or replace concrete is important for safety and cost-effectiveness. Minor cracks and chips are simple to repair when tackled promptly. Conversely, extensive deterioration may require expert repair or complete replacement to avert further issues.
